On Thu, Sep 18, 2003 at 12:39:47AM +0000, Nielsen wrote:
> It seems (at least for me) the patches on ftp.freebsd.org are out of 
> date for the 03:12 security advisory (openssh). ftp2.freebsd.org has 
> them fine.
> 
> I'm wondering if this is a mirror issue or perhaps round-robin DNS problem?
> 
> What compounds the issue is that right now the old openssh 3.7 patches 
> are there (on ftp.freebsd.org), but not the 3.7.1 patches (which can be 
> found on ftp2.freebsd.org). This could conceivably cause someone to miss 
> a patch.
> 
> Am i doing something wrong? If not, then this is just a little heads up. 
> Perhaps it would be better to include ftp2.freebsd.org links in the 
> security advisories.
> 
> Hate to complain. The FreeBSD security team has done a great job, 
> especially in the midst of this whole openssh mess.

I always manually update ftp.freebsd.org (62.243.72.50) and
ftp2.freebsd.org.  The problem is, it seems, that recently a 2nd
ftp.freebsd.org was added to DNS.  (Seems like a really bad idea to
me, but *shrug*.)  I do not have access to this new machine, and
indeed I'm not sure exactly who runs it.  It is on my TODO list to
find out and ask for a means to run manual updates there as well.
